It’s the equinox, spring has sprung…or has it? Mini-Beast from the East has the nerve (agents) to spoil our spring, so I thought I’d do what I did with #278 and force the snow to disappear again with a podcast, and it seems to have worked. Yr welcome!
The show is dedicated to Professor Stephen Hawking, black holes, snowcastles and distant friends and their ghost(ly) presences with a wide range of music from metal covers of Adele and Drake, to new-ish hiphop from RTJ and EBM, Icelandic composers, retro and new mashups and electronica, post-rock and even a Bollywood meets modern disco, classic space disco and funk knees up!
If you can’t find anything to like here you are either dead, under a pile of snow, or into purely modern jazz.
